Description

Digby Estate No 86 and Digby Estate No 87, also known as Sunny Cottage, is a pair of houses dating from 1625. They feature 19th-century fronts and are two stories high with two window bays and a central doorway for each house. The roofs are slate with a gabled design, having a red tile ridge, stone slates towards the verge, and stone coping with kneelers. The front is made of stone rubble. Each house has small two-light segmental headed casement windows and segmental headed doorways, which have ledged doors set in frames. Digby Estate Nos 85 to 88, along with Keld and Homestead, form a group.
